Yanosvkaya / Mozgov only couple to dance to qualify for the final full score

The Russians Anna Yanvoskaya / Sergei Mozgov have qualified for the final of the Junior Grand Prix circuit of entering the stage hosted by & ldquo; Dom Sportova & rdquo; Zagreb.

The defending champions have come out winners in both segments of the race, but confirmed the perplexity & agrave; on the technical front emerged in the short-dance yesterday. Impeccable on the lift, they again paid duty on the level of twizzles without being able to shift the balance with the sequences of steps in pairs. Yanovskaya / Mozgov (145.34), higher than the competition for stage presence, maturity & agrave; and speed & agrave ;, were able to make a difference with the components of the program, but, of course, in the tango today unveiled andr & agrave; revised pi & ugrave; of a particular order to avoid unpleasant surprises when the opponents will be a very different level. Nell & rsquo; occasion, the couple trained in Moscow by the team led by Svetlana Alexeeva won the sixth stage of success in a Junior Grand Prix, including last year's final. In second place, we have placed the statutinensi Rachel Parsons / Michael Parsons (140.33), euphoric in kiss and cry for today's performance that & egrave; earned a new personal record with an increase of well over five points. The students of Alexei Kiliakov have also climbed in the overall training mates McNamara / Carpenter becoming the first substitute for the final in Barcelona. The brothers of Rockville have unlined in Zagreb two technical performance of massive solidity & agrave; outperforming the pi & ugrave; Russians listed on twizzles and step sequences. The podium & egrave; was completed by the Hungarian-Italian couple consisting Carolina Moscheni and Lukasz Adam (135,96), which obtained the best result of his career in the circuit with a growth of over eight points compared to the previous personal record. & Nbsp; fellowship trained by Barbara Fusar Poli confirmed the positive impression aroused in the stage of Tallinn getting the approval of the judges on each of the elements presented. Moreover, the levels at hand, there are plenty of room for growth that bodes well for the World Championships juniors. The Russians Daria Morozova / Alexei Zhirnov (120.54), surprise winners of the stage of Ljubljana, defended tooth fourth place by the return of Ukrainians Valeria Gaistruk / Alexeyi Olejnik (119.07) failing to qualify for the final with the complicit & agrave; a calendar rather favorable. Goal reached in part, the performance in Croatia proved to be extremely disappointing and huge gaps have emerged on the sequences of steps of any kind.
